Transaction 848c2926ac3dd66841de51d70f1814958d1eeb88d85f00d62cda21367599b349
1 Input
1 Output
-
848c2926ac3dd66841de51d70f1814958d1eeb88d85f00d62cda21367599b349:0
- value
- 31709
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 3c9a9aa63d39d9a23a056805eff6050d99d81c53 OP_EQUAL
- address
- 37DTg8mQVADSQeLXYEa1v1UZpeKBaCFoWA